Robinsons are delighted to offer to the market this well presented extended four bedroom detached family home, situated on the popular and sought-after location of Aiden's Walk, Ferryhill. The property is ideally located for access to the A1 and A19, close to local schooling, amenities and other transport links making this a perfect home for numerous buyers so early viewing is advised to avoid any disappointment. This stunning home has an endless amount of benefits and some of its key features are; spacious lounge, beautiful white large kitchen, off road parking and good sized easy to maintain garden. In our opinion the property would be a perfect purchase for any first time buyer or growing family, giving all of the above.

In brief the property comprise of; entrance hallway, ground floor W/C, large open plan lounge / dining room, which gives access to the lovely sunroom extension and good sized kitchen / breakfast room. To the first floor is four good sized bedrooms with master having the added bonus of fitted wardrobes and En-suite, the family bathroom is also located to the first floor. Externally to the front elevation there is an easy to maintain garden and driveway which leads to a garage. While to the rear there is a pleasant garden and patio which enjoys views to the side of the property.

Hallway - Radiator, stairs to the first floor.

W/C - Fully tiled, w/c, wash hand basin, hand towel radiator, uPVC window.

Lounge/Diner - 6.43m x 3.38m (21'1 x 11'1) - UPVC window, radiator, gas fire and surround, French doors leading to the sun room.

Sun Room - 3.07m x 3.05m max points (10'1 x 10'0 max points) - UPVC windows, access to the rear garden.

Kitchen/Breakfast Room - 5.21m x 2.95m (17'1 x 9'8) - Modern white wall and base units, integrated oven, hob, extractor fan, plumed for washing machine, uPVC window, tiled splashbacks, uPVC window, space for dining table, stainless steel sink with mixer tap and drainer, access to the garage, large storage cupboard.

Landing - Loft access.

Bedroom One - 4.09m x 3.48m max points (13'5 x 11'5 max points) - UPVC window, radiator, fitted wardrobes.

En-Suite - Shower cubicle, wash hand basin, w/c, half tiled, hand towel radiator, uPVC window.

Bedroom Two - 3.12m x 2.36m (10'3 x 7'9) - UPVC window, radiator, fitted wardrobes.

Bedroom Three - 4.09m x 2.01m (13'5 x 6'7) - UPVC window, radiator, fitted wardrobes.

Bedroom Four - 2.16m x 2.24m (7'1 x 7'4) - UPVC window, radiator.

Bathroom - 2.13m x 1.65m (7'0 x 5'5) - Panelled bath with shower over, wash hand basin, w/c, hand towel radiator, uPVC window, fully tiled.

Externally - To the front elevation, there is a easy to maintain garden and driveway which leads to the garage. Whilst to the rear, there is a private pleasant garden which enjoys some beautiful views.

Garage - 5.00m x 2.57m (16'5 x 8'5) - Power and Lighting.

Agent Notes - Electricity Supply: Mains
Water Supply: Mains
Sewerage: Mains
Heating: Gas Central Heating
Broadband: Ultrafast 9000 Mbps
Mobile Signal/Coverage: Good to Average depending on provider
Tenure: Freehold
Council Tax: Durham County Council, Band C - Approx. £2,073.51 p.a
Energy Rating: D

Spennymoor local information A town in County Durham, Spennymoor was founded in the 1850s and stands above the Wear Valley. Some of the most notable landmarks of the town include Whitworth Hall, a famous estate well known for its inclusion in the nursery rhyme “Bobby Shafto’s gone to Sea”. It is now a site for a well-farmed deer park, which is enclosed by a walled garden.  Spennymoor Settlement is a centre for the fine arts, with drama and music events regularly appearing in the building, amongst other community events. There are also plans for a brand new Regional Arts Centre.  The local football team is Spennymoor Town F.C and the leisure centre includes the local swimming pool, which offers swimming lessons, football coaching, martial arts tutoring, tennis lessons, badminton practice, a gymnasium and gymnastic workouts. The site is also home to a modern Regional Gymnasium Centre, made possible by a portion of funding from the National Lottery and Sport England.
